The CSI5* 1m60 Grand Prix at the H.H. Amir’s Sword in Doha brought together 44 combinations in a demanding two-round competition followed by a jump-off. Thirteen riders progressed to the decisive phase, where the battle for victory was ultimately determined against the clock.
Abdullah Alsharbatly secured the win in the saddle of Diriyah (Baloubet du Rouet) after producing a faultless jump-off in 36.29 seconds. Khaled Almobty followed closely aboard Diana du Plevau Z (Dieu Merci van t&l), also delivering a clear performance in 37.45 seconds.
Third place went to Pieter Devos on the back of Casual Dv Z (Cornet Obolensky), who remained faultless throughout and stopped the clock at 39.20 seconds in the jump-off. Christian Ahlmann finished just behind with Untouched LB (United Touch s), crossing the line in 39.24 seconds without penalties.
Anastasia Nielsen completed the top five aboard Esi Rocky (Stakkato Gold), producing another clear jump-off in 42.59 seconds.
